Akinori Iwamura / Iwamura interested in long-term deal
FantasySP / ALL / Player News — The Pittsburgh Post-Gazette is reporting that new Pirate second baseman Akinori Iwamura said in a conference call on Tuesday that he would be interested in exploring a long-term deal with the team. Iwamura played in only 69 games last season due to a knee injury. Our View: Iwamura sounded excited to be with the Pirates, but what else is he going to say? He was in a great situation in Tampa, and now he is with a perennial loser in the Pirates. He should be in line for a bounce back season, however, playing in the National League. ...

Akinori Iwamura / Pirates | To approach Iwamura about extensionFantasySP / ALL / Player News
The Pittsburgh Post-Gazette's Dejan Kovacevic reports Pittsburgh Pirates general manager Neal Huntington said the team will approach 2B Akinori Iwamura about a contract extension after the team exercised his $4.85 million option for 2010. Read more Akinori_Iwamura news
